Red Bank Pair Indicted In DSW Thefts

The pair worked together to steal items from the shoe and accessories store in Eatontown, authorities say.

Two Red Bank residents have been indicted by a Monmouth County grand jury on charges of theft and conspiracy in connection with a series of thefts from DSW in Eatontown from September through November 2014, according to court documents.

Kristie George, 41, and Nequan George, 26, both of Dr. James Parker Boulevard, were indicted in the incidents, with occurred over the course of several dates between Sept. 26 and Nov. 26, according to the documents.

According to the documents, Nequan George would go into DSW (Designer Shoe Warehouse) and select several items to purchase. He would then take them to the register where Kristie George was the cashier and she would ring up some of the items, but not all. Nequan George would then leave the store with all of the items, according to the indictment paperwork.

Among the items stolen were shoes, scarves, handbags, according to the indictment.
